Web30 mrt. 2024 · In general, hydrocracking units are operated in the following range of operating conditions: 350–430 °C, 7–20 MPa, space velocity of 0.3–2.0 h −1 and hydrogen to feedstock ratio of 800–1800 Nm 3 /m 3 [ 24 ].
